Musicians multitask all the time. You have to work the tasks separately and with time and practice you will eventually be able to. Such as a pianist keeping a stride rhythm in their left hand while simultaneously playing a melody which is nothing like that chord pattern. Or a guitarist strumming chord changes, the right hand and left hand have two completely different tasks they need to do well to play the instrument. Add in singing on top of it and there's three, oh don't forget to make eye contact/engage with the audience too while you're at it.
